Output 508f27971b6588994cc30467783bcc48131b48022265939f160c3290e4ddef7b:3

value
306878
script pubkey
OP_0 OP_PUSHBYTES_20 cc8d4c4345e1c9effdb0e35c83d6fe68df0a90d5
address
bc1qejx5cs69u8y7lldsudwg84h7dr0s4yx4x9rh29
transaction
508f27971b6588994cc30467783bcc48131b48022265939f160c3290e4ddef7b
confirmations
157462
spent
true